Output 0283d80069d71d01a96dbf9560bb206bb384e22297ddce4a63b81722b3b1b875:23

value
6442760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d267f50f79cbef0161459afaa6e2013b32cee969 OP_EQUAL
address
3LsYMuV4RKM8oxtgBQi9Pd4Nq4TTVo4e8T
transaction
0283d80069d71d01a96dbf9560bb206bb384e22297ddce4a63b81722b3b1b875
confirmations
225144
spent
true